Default Packet writing possible?

I wonder if the BD format will support direct packet writing to disk. What this allows, is files to be copied without having to add and finalize another session.

My current backup program, Retrospect uses a form of packet writing to store data effectively and quickly during backups, however since its not a standard thing.

I'm going to guess that the BD *hardware* will support most multisession functions like DVD and CD hardware, but not sure if by default the software will be able to understand non-session packet written data on BD-R media.
